The New Light on Tibetan Medicine series brings together Dr. Pasang Yonten Arya's extensive educational materials for the first time. Building on five decades of study, clinical practice, and teaching, this set of comprehensive textbooks aims to provide a unique contemporary overview of the science of healing known as Sowa Rigpa. No English-language publication of comparable scope has appeared so far. This series is therefore an essential guide and reference for students of Tibetan, Asian, and Buddhist medical traditions, as well as for health professionals, therapists, and researchers.

Methods is the second volume of the New Light series. This textbook systematically lays out the vast Tibetan medical arsenal of approaches and techniques that facilitate both diagnosis and treatment. Clarifying and building on the foundational classic the Four Tantras (Gy�zhi) in combination with key traditional commentaries, it provides an unprecedented practical synthesis relevant and applicable in this day and age. In addition to covering standard diagnostics such as anamnesis, pulse reading and analyses of body constitution, urine, and tongue, innovative additional techniques including lingual, eye and ear vein reading receive special attention. In terms of treatment, dietetics is particularly extensive, with more than 200 classified foods and beverages. Besides chapters on pharmacy and a total of 20 internal and external therapies, the Appendix also contains a table characterizing more than 380 single ingredients and a highly useful indications list of 100 medicinal formulas.

Arya, Pasang Yonten: - "Dr. Pasang Yonten Arya (Menrampa) is an internationally renowned senior practitioner, scholar, and teacher of Sowa Rigpa. He trained at Men-Tsee-Khang in Dharamsala, where he graduated first of his class in 1977 and served as assistant pharmacist, professor, and college principal until 1989. After lecturing at the Central Institute for Buddhist Studies (Ladakh, 1989-1991), he moved to Europe, where he acted as guest professor in Tibetan medicine for DÄGfA (the German Medical Association for Acupuncture) for more than two decades. He co-founded the New Yuthok Institute (Italy) as well as TME - Tibetan Medicine Education Center (Switzerland), through which he has instructed hundreds of students on clinical, yogic, and tantric knowledge and practices that balance the body-mind."
